#12cee9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#12cee9 is composed of 7.1% red, 80.8% green and 91.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 92.3% cyan, 11.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 187.5 degrees, a saturation of 85.7% and a lightness of 49.2%. #12cee9 color hex could be obtained by blending #24ffff with #009dd3. Closest websafe color is: #00ccff.

Shades and Tints of #12cee9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010d0e is the darkest color, while #fbfe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#12cee9

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7c7e7f is the less saturated color, while #08d5f3 is the most saturated one.
